Know The Room: Dating Jewish Singles With Respect

If you feel unsure about saying the right thing, that’s normal—being thoughtful matters more than having perfect words. When dating Jewish singles on Mingle2, use the category as helpful context rather than a label that defines a person.

Start with open curiosity, not assumptions. People who identify as Jewish have a wide range of backgrounds, beliefs, and practices. Ask gentle, open-ended questions like “What’s meaningful to you?” or “How do you like to celebrate holidays?” rather than assuming observance, politics, or traditions.

Be specific about your intentions and listen. If you’re looking for a serious relationship, casual dating, or just getting to know people, say so respectfully. Give space for your match to share boundaries, family expectations, or cultural priorities—and respect them.

Avoid stereotypes and casual shorthand. Don’t rely on jokes or one-line assumptions about food, religion, or culture. If you’re unsure whether a topic is appropriate, ask if they’re comfortable talking about it rather than guessing.

Use respectful language and names. If someone mentions particular terms, holidays, or roles, mirror their language and ask for clarification when you need it. Pronunciation and terminology matter to many people; asking politely shows care.

Show genuine interest beyond labels. Notice hobbies, values, and everyday life. Mentioning a detail from their profile—whether it’s a book, a job, or a hobby—signals that you see them as a whole person, not just as a category.

Respect family and cultural considerations. For many people, family and cultural traditions can shape dating expectations. Ask about these topics with sensitivity and be ready to negotiate differences with kindness and practicality.

When in doubt, ask and listen. Honest curiosity and attentive listening are better than assumptions. If conversations touch on sensitive or personal subjects, give space, acknowledge differences, and follow the lead of the person you’re talking to.

Approach every interaction on Mingle2 with humility and warmth—treat the category as context that can deepen connection, not as a definition that limits it.

Dating Confidence Reset

If online dating has left you tired, invisible, or unsure what you want, start by clarifying one clear intention for your time on Mingle2 — whether it’s meeting new people, practicing conversation, or exploring potential partners. Writing a short, honest goal (for example: “I want two good conversations a week” or “I’m exploring long-term possibilities”) makes choices easier and reduces the noise.

Practical Steps To Build Steady Confidence

  • Set realistic expectations. Accept that not every match will click. Treat each conversation as information: it teaches you what you like and what you don’t.
  • Pace conversations. Move slowly enough to learn about values and communication style, but quickly enough to avoid endless chatting that goes nowhere. Aim for a few thoughtful messages before suggesting a voice call or casual meet-up.
  • Choose quality over quantity. Instead of swiping endlessly, spend more time on profiles that genuinely pique your interest. One focused conversation is more valuable than ten shallow ones.
  • Track small wins. Notice progress like clearer boundaries, better questions, or fewer stale chats. These are real signs of growth even if a match doesn’t lead to something long-term.
  • Guard your emotional energy. Limit daily app time, pause after a rough streak, and do things that restore you so dating doesn’t become your whole identity.

Conversation Practices That Help

  • Ask open, specific questions. “What’s a weekend you enjoyed recently?” gets more useful answers than “How was your weekend?”
  • Share a short, honest snapshot of yourself. One or two lines about what matters to you invites reciprocity without oversharing.
  • Be clear about next steps. If you want to meet, say so with a low-pressure plan: “Would you like to grab coffee this weekend?” Clarity saves time and reduces guessing.

Keep Perspective

Rejection or slow replies are normal and rarely personal. When you feel discouraged, revisit your initial intention and the small wins you’ve recorded. Confidence grows through steady practice, not through a single match. Treat Mingle2 as a place to try, learn, and be selective — and return to the app when you feel curious again, not compelled.

Small, consistent steps — clearer goals, thoughtful pacing, and protecting your energy — will reset your dating confidence and make each interaction feel more meaningful.
